Exploring Different Kinds Of Roof and Their Distinct Layouts for Your Home When thinking about home renovations, the choice of roof material is essential, not just for visual appeal however likewise for long-term sturdiness and power performance. Roofing Contractors Oahu. Asphalt roof shingles, for example, supply an affordable option with https://perthroofandgutterrepairs31851.wikiadvocate.com/6668328/high_quality_repairs_and_installation_by_roofing_companies_oahu_you_can_rely_on